Q: Is 420,002,343 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 420,002,343 is not a prime number.

Why is 420,002,343 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 420002343 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 269 807 2,421 173,483 520,449 1,561,347 46,666,927 140,000,781 and 420,002,343, with no remainder.

Since 420,002,343 cannot be divided by just 1 and 420,002,343, it is not a prime number.
